About this ebook

This is a true story, based on thirteen years of research.

It is the story of friendship between a Jewish boy Freddy and his Christian friend Helmut who are separated by the
political turmoil of the aftermath of the first World War in Germany, that obliged him and his family to seek refuge in France.

It is the story of friendship between Freddy and George, his classmate whom he meets in school in Paris.

It is the Story of Sigmund, whose patriotic blindness
impacted the life of his whole family.

I always felt the urge to write this story, to tell it freely,
without any literary or formal restrictions, thus allowing the soul of the characters with all their qualities and misgivings to shine through it.

Now, after all these years, it has finally seen the light of day.

Author

Alice Weil

Alice Weil is half-American and half-German. She grew up in Colombia and attended French and German schools, therefore, becoming fluent in four languages. She has three children and seven grandchildren. After having travelled all over the world, she immersed herself in the spiritual teachings of India, and lives by these teachings, which have enabled her to serve others, thus living her dharma or life’s purpose. This is her fourth book.
